Sometimes alternative text (i.e., alt txt) is the most edifying and important part of a tooted photo. It can be delightful and memorable, like artfully crafted literature or original metaphors. As a sighted person, I save viewing the alt text for the last and possibly best part, anticipating it like extra frosting that has tumbled onto my plate from a slice of cake. Alt text sometimes merely explains what I am viewing; other times it draws my attention to special details in a photo that I would have otherwise missed. For those with visual impairments, it is essential, of course. Regrettably, alt text is sometimes banal or missing altogether. When you read exceptional alt text, do you ever compliment its author?
